12. conventions..
of experimental music videos
• he beauty of the experimental genre is that is challenges
conventions and has a style of its own. that being said it is
still important to maintain somewhat of a sense of familiarity
with the audience through plot, camera angles, lip-syncing,
etc.
• experimental with lighting
• use of green screen
• playful with animations
• led by some sort of narrative surrounding the animation
• little correlation between visual and lyrics, but rather
matching the rythmn and mood of the song
• use of fish eye lens and experimental angles
